Transaction 670ed7601e0edefe176b4c1ffdeace15b576154a403c2d224f22c36d2ed83d7f

1 Input
2 Outputs
  • 670ed7601e0edefe176b4c1ffdeace15b576154a403c2d224f22c36d2ed83d7f:0
  • value  124010855
    address  3HHnTAAVVcXctiCm3AN6vPANbTArp92LMV
  • 670ed7601e0edefe176b4c1ffdeace15b576154a403c2d224f22c36d2ed83d7f:1
  • value  5000000
    address  34fEF5DLu2ivw5ZaUbNfSavfwsDFJd6LxM